Effect of Sodium Chloride on Growth, Glucose Utilization, and Acid Production in Proteus Vulgaris.

During an evaluation of selective plating media for identification of coagulase-positive staphylococci in foods, two strains of Proteus vulgaris produced wider zones of acidity on plates containing NaCl than on those without the salt. Subsequent experiments showed that NaCl was responsible and that it also increased acid production in broth. Because P. vulgaris frequently interferes with the isolation from foods of organisms of public health significance, the effect of NaCl on the growth of the organism was thought worthy of further study.
